摘  要:茶叶机械化符合我国茶叶生产大国的客观现实,能从根本上促进我国茶产业的发展。文章应用研究整合法,从机械概况、能源使用及技术创新等方面阐明近年来我国茶叶机械发展状况,并就目前存在的问题进行分析。我国茶叶机械发展起步较晚,初制机械研究发展速度较快,精制机械、茶园机械发展速度相对较慢,茶叶单机设备相对较为成熟,加工生产线部分可实现连续化。茶叶机械能源的使用趋于清洁化、节能化。高新技术的应用为茶叶机械的自动化、智能化发展注入新动力。但总体而言,茶叶机械仍存在标准化水平低,与工艺技术融合不够等问题,需要政府、茶机企业、技术人员和茶农的通力合作,共同促进我国茶机行业更好、更快地发展。Tea mechanization accords with the objective reality of China as a big tea producer and can fundamentally promote the development of China's tea industry.This study expounds the development of tea machinery in China in recent years from the aspects of its general situation,energy using and technological innovation,and analyzes the existing problems.The results showed that the development of tea machinery in China started late,the research on primary processing machinery developed rapidly while the refining machinery and tea garden machinery was relatively slow.Most of the single machine equipment of tea was mature,and most of the processing production lines could work in a continuous way.The use of tea machinery energy tends to be cleaner and energy-efficient.The application of high and new technology has injected new impetus into the automation and intelligent development of tea machinery.But on the whole,there are still some problems such as low standardization level and insufficient integration with process technology.This requires the cooperation of the government,tea machine enterprises,technical researchers and tea growers to promote China's tea machine industry development better and faster.
